Wilhelm Bichl (born 3 February 1949 in Hall in Tirol) was an Austrian luger who competed in the late 1960s. He won a gold medal in the men's doubles event at the 1967 FIL European Luge Championships in Königssee, West Germany.[1]

Bichl also finished seventh in the men's doubles event at the 1968 Winter Olympics in Grenoble.
